Tiivistelmä
In recent years, increasing pressure has been placed on urban last-mile delivery systems due to rising e-commerce demand, higher customer expectations, and growing concerns related to congestion and sustainability. As a result, alternative delivery solutions, including drone delivery, have attracted significant attention.

The objective of the study was to examine the role of drone delivery in urban last-mile logistics by analysing three key aspects: the challenges faced by current delivery systems, the reasons drone delivery is considered important and innovative, and the barriers that limit its practical implementation.

The study was conducted using a qualitative research approach based on a literature review. Academic articles, industry reports, and applied research publications were collected from databases such as Google Scholar, ScienceDirect, and Theseus. The data were analysed using a thematic analysis method, which enabled the identification of recurring patterns and key themes across the selected sources.

The results indicate that urban last-mile delivery systems face structural challenges related to high operational costs, congestion, complex delivery conditions, and increasing service expectations. Drone delivery is identified as a potentially valuable complementary solution, particularly in situations requiring speed, direct routing, and time-sensitive delivery. However, significant barriers remain, including technical limitations, regulatory constraints, operational complexity, and issues related to public acceptance.

It was concluded that drone delivery should not be regarded as a universal replacement for conventional delivery systems, but rather as a context-dependent and supplementary solution. Its future role in urban logistics depends on the coordinated development of technology, regulation, infrastructure, and social acceptance.
